      Hi, from MOE website:

      “3. Receive outcome and report to school

      You will receive the outcome of your child's application through SMS sent to the local mobile number you have provided during your application. You may also log on to the online system using your Singpass.

      Microsoft Edge is recommended for optimal use of this online system.

      If you choose to accept the school offered, follow these steps to complete the transfer process:
      Report to the current school to initiate the process.
      Report to the new school.

      This process must be completed within the reporting period. If you miss the reporting deadline, or decide not to accept the school offered, your child will remain in their current school.”

      There is no official appeal process. What I would do is:
      - simply let the deadline pass without action. Child will then officially stay in his old school
      - since the desired school seems to have vacancies, just apply directly to the desired school (walk-in to the general office once Term 1 starts / call them to check transfer application procedure / use online transfer or query form if available).
      - MP route if u think it’s faster

      All the best![/quote]
